Power Rankings: Can Anyone Dethrone Tampa?

(Photo by Elsa/Getty Images)

Tampa Bay has been one of the most consistent and dominant teams in the NHL. It is safe to say that the Tampa Bay Lightning are the most well-rounded team in hockey. They have finished near or at the top of all of Uncut’s power rankings. So can a streaking team dethrone Tampa? Let’s take a look at the ten teams that have had the best season so far.

10. Edmonton Oilers

The Oilers have the best player in Connor McDavid for years to come so it is no surprise they rank in the top ten. McDavid is barely shy of a rare two-point per game pace. Only a few NHLers have ever reached this pace over a full season. The most famous of which Wayne Gretzky who did so on numerous occasions. So the fact that McDavid can come closer than most to this pace pays dividends for Edmonton.

9. Toronto Maple Leafs

The Leafs had the most threatening offense earlier this season. However, their goaltending has been underwhelming so far and the Leafs have had trouble outscoring the opposition of late. Nevertheless, they are still first in the North. Their sizeable lead at the beginning of the season has allowed them to stay in a relatively good spot in the standings despite their troubles of late. If Toronto cannot figure things out quickly, Edmonton and Winnipeg are lurking right behind.

8. Pittsburgh Penguins

The Penguins have been doing exceptional of late. They are 7-3-0 in their last ten games and top-three in the East. Despite injuries to key players, Pittsburgh has played a well-rounded game. They are sixth in goals for and twelfth in goals allowed. Pittsburgh has seemed to shake off their mediocre start as goaltending has improved significantly.

7. Minnesota Wild

The Wild have been one of the most successful teams regarding defense and young talent. They have some of the best shutdown defensemen in the league. Names that come to mind include Mathew Dumba, Jonas Brodin, Jared Spurgeon, and Ryan Suter. Additionally, the rookie phenoms Kirill Kaprizov and Kaapo Kahkonen gave been crucial in the team’s success.

6. Las Vegas Golden Knights

The Knights have been the most dominant team in the West nearly the entire season. Their success is largely due to the likes of the defense and goaltending. Alec Martinez, Shea Theodore, and Alex Pietrangelo have all been amazing in the defensive end. However, their performance comes nowhere close to Marc-Andre Fleury. Fleury has controlled the crease better than most this season and there would be uproar in Vegas if he did not receive Vezina votes.

5. Colorado Avalanche

The Avs have been playing great hockey of late. They have finally caught up to Vegas in the West standings. However, their offense has been much more threatening. Colorado is third in goals scored in the NHL and tied with Vegas for the second-fewest allowed. When a team can score and play defense to that caliber, they will be a force to be reckoned with come playoffs time.

4. Carolina Hurricanes

Carolina’s game has succeeded in all areas. They have better depth than most NHL teams. This has allowed Head Coach Rob Brind’Amour to slot players line Andrei Svechnikov on the third line. So the Hurricanes are one of very few teams who have stars throughout their lines. While goaltending was a concern, Alex Nedeljkovic, stepped in for the injured Petr Mrazek and has been consistent.

3. Washington Capitals

The Capitals have been exceptional. They are 8-2-0 in their last ten and have fired on all cylinders to this point. Their offense is stellar. Led by Alex Ovechkin and Nicklas Backstrom, the Caps have scored the fourth-most goals in the NHL. They had a big boost to the roster once starting netminder Ilya Samsonov returned. Now, Washington has a reliable tandem in net when there were concerns earlier in the season.

2. New York Islanders

The Islanders have managed to stay ahead of the Caps and Pens in the top-heavy East. The Islanders have been consistent over the last two months. They have one nineteen of their last twenty-five games. Their success has been largely due to goaltending. The tandem of Semyon Varlamov and Ilya Sorokin has been exceptional. They have given the Isles a chance to win every single night.

1. Tampa Bay Lightning

Tampa has yet again emerged as the number one spot on Uncut’s power rankings. They have the best all-around team. They are first in goals, fifth in goals against, and have numerous players who could walk away with hardware at the end of the season. To name a few Victor Hedman is the Norris favorite as of right now and Andrei Vasilevskiy is the Vezina favorite. A team with so much star power is hard to go against so no team managed to dethrone Tampa this week.
